"This is convenient timing. The New York Times' Helene Cooper and Michael Landry report Iran has finally agreed to sit down for the first time for one-on-one negotiations with the U.S. over their controversial nuclear program.

The catch: they won't sit down until after the election is over. They don't want to start negotiating with a President who may or may not be there in two weeks.

But the agreement is a big get for Obama, the culmination of four years of "secret, intense" negotiations between the two sides.

There are a bunch of other logistics to work out, including getting final, official say from Iran's supreme le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ei.

Top officials have agreed to the talks but Ali Khamenei hasn't signed off.

Israel was pretty skeptical Iran would be productive when they spoke to the Times. Israel's spent much of the last year drawing red lines for Iran's controversial nuclear program. They don't want Iran to go over a certain enrichment level without incurring the wrath of an attack.

Skeptics are already saying the agreement is an effort from Iran to ease international tension on them.

Others are saying they're bending to the sanctions that are tanking their economy"

I hate to put a damper on something that would have been welcome news but it seems the White House is now denying this report:

"The Obama administration has moved quickly to water down a report that the US and Iran have agreed in principle to meet one-on-one for negotiations on Iran's nuclear programme.

The New York Times said secret talks between officials that began early in Barack Obama's term as president had delivered the provisional agreement. Iran had insisted the talks wait until after the November presidential election, the New York Times said, attributing the information to a senior official in the Obama administration.

However the National Security Council spokesman Tommy Vietor said in response that the United States would continue to work with fellow permanent members of the UN security council and Germany.

"It's not true that the United States and Iran have agreed to one-on-one talks or any meeting after the American elections," the statement said.

"We continue to work with the P5+1 [five permanent members of the UN security council plus Germany] on a diplomatic solution and have said from the outset that we would be prepared to meet bilaterally
."
